Popis: Despite various criticisms about Information and Communications Technologies (ICT), onecannot dismiss in a hurry that life is mucheasier today thanks to ICT. Indeed, advances in technology haveimproved gathering and sharing of information, ways ofdoing business and medical care. What is more,religious perspectives are also changing courtesy of new technologies. To thisend, this qualitative study titled “ICT, Catechesis and Marriage and the Family in the Church in Nigeria: A Qualitative Study”employed thegrounded theory to ascertain the role of ICT in aiding all-round catechesis within marriage and the family inthecountry. As regards objective/purpose, the study sought to investigate the place of ICT in entrenchingCatechesis in Marriageand the family in the Church in Nigeria. It found lack of embracing e-catechesis andedutainment as well as initiating amultidimensional approach to catechesis as reasons for the impasse. Itrecommended initiating e-catechesis, infotainment and amultidimensional approach to catechesis as waysout. The study concluded that marriage and the family would be spirituallyenriched if the Church’s hierarchyin Nigeria direct the way in employing ICT for teaching all-round catechesis.
